基于病毒学和组织学发现的DNA-RNA病毒相互作用动物模型。

An animal model for DNA-RNA virus interaction based upon virological and histological findings.

作者信息

Hsiung G D, McTighe A H

出版信息

Cancer Res. 1976 Feb;36(2 pt 2):674-7.

PMID:1253155
Abstract

The presence of endogenous oncornavirus and herpesvirus in guinea pigs has been established. The oncornavirus apparently is present in all guinea pigs but is expressed only under certain conditions. Expression of the latent herpesvirus is generally age and strain dependent as is the development of spontaneous guinea pig leukemia. Following special laboratory manipulation, expression of both virus types was accomplished in vitro. Studies of the role played by these two virus types in the development of neoplastic disease in guinea pigs revealed that, in the presence of the endogenous oncornavirus, a superinfection with herpesvirus led to the development of self-limited lymphoproliferative changes. Together with the studies reported by other investigators, it appears that interaction between the DNA and RNA viruses may play an important role in the natural occurrence of viral oncogenesis. Guinea pigs provide an intriguing animal model for the study of herpesvirus and oncornavirus interaction both in vivo and in vitro.

摘要

豚鼠体内存在内源性肿瘤病毒和疱疹病毒已得到证实。肿瘤病毒显然存在于所有豚鼠体内,但仅在某些条件下才会表达。潜伏性疱疹病毒的表达通常与年龄和品系有关,自发性豚鼠白血病的发展也是如此。经过特殊的实验室操作,两种病毒类型均在体外实现了表达。对这两种病毒类型在豚鼠肿瘤性疾病发展中所起作用的研究表明,在内源性肿瘤病毒存在的情况下,疱疹病毒的重复感染会导致自限性淋巴细胞增生性变化。与其他研究者报告的研究结果一起表明,DNA病毒和RNA病毒之间的相互作用可能在病毒致癌作用的自然发生中起重要作用。豚鼠为体内外研究疱疹病毒和肿瘤病毒的相互作用提供了一个有趣的动物模型。
